Russ E Posted September 1, 2017 Posted September 1, 2017 I use the lightest possible for the conditions. it depends on the weed density and depth i am trying to reach. if the weeds are sparse I will use no weight to 1/4 oz. if I have to punch through a mat I will go up to 3/8 - 3/4 oz. 4 Quote
